Maiden my 300 a few day ago I don't have enough time to say how well this airframe performs! Like many other people I have owned many 50cc airframes but, nothing like this one. Ya gotta fly it to believe it! I am using a MT-57 / 23/8 wood prop with stock muffler. Hover is just at 1/2 throttle with a strong pull out. This airframe is very light on the wings which makes for a fun time. In IMAC style of flying the plane tracks as good as my 35% EXTRA 260. This is one sweet ride.......... I will be looking to buy the new 100cc version as soon as it is available. I wish I could pass the transmitter to anyone who is on the fence to buy one. You would be swayed in a hurry! The airplanes I can compare it to (which I have flown) are 88 EF yak and HH Carden yak. All three are wonderful airframes but the EXRTA 300shp is a little more forgiving in any type of rollers. AUW is 16.5 lbs. floats like a feather.
3-D Hobby Shop keep up the good work and my wallet will thank you!

Yep....mine came in at 17.5 dry.....that's with header, MTW75K canister, a smoke system and cockpit/pilot and A123 batts. Full fuel & smoke tank I'm just shy of 18 lbs. Even at that it floats like a buttafly

Just finished my first IMAC contest. Came in 4th in Sportsman...some lousy flights (not the SHP's fault) plus some very nice ones. Plane displayed well in the air. Lot's of questions from seasoned IMAC folks!
